Installing a new window

Installing a brand new double-glazed window can increase the comfort of your home. It can also reduce your energy bills. It is essential to know the process.

The first step in installing a new window is to measure your home. This could take a few hours so it is recommended to start early. Engaging a professional for the installation can save you a lot of headache. Make sure you have precise measurements. If you are not sure about the size of window you need, you can get some help from a professional in the field of windows.

Then, the installers have to take down the old window. Leaving the old one in place can cause problems. They will also need to remove any decorations from the window. They should also break the seal.

After removal of the glass and sashes after which they can cut the frame to fit. Be careful not to scratch the plaster or brickwork. To protect yourself wear safety goggles and gloves.

After the frame has been cut to the correct size, it's time to put the window in place. There are many different types of spacers used. Each manufacturer has their own procedure for installation. For example, some windows require a gap at the bottom of the sills to drain the water. Some windows are smaller.

After the window has been fitted after installation, you can apply a layer of paintable caulk on both the exterior and the inside. You may also want to complete the inside of the window by staining or painting the wood trim.

Apply PVC super glue at the ends of your sill. Attach the stops using screws.

A double-glazed window could last for 15 to 20 years. It depends on the type and quality of the window. If the windows are improperly installed, it may hinder their efficiency.

Cost of opening a new window

Double-paned glass windows are a great option to boost the energy efficiency of your home. They can also be used to block out cold and noise from outside. They are available in a diverse range of styles and materials.

A variety of factors contribute to the price of window replacement. The most significant factor is the material that is used. There are many materials available that offer different levels of insulation and durability.

The frame itself is also an important factor. Vinyl is the most affordable, but it is less durable than wooden frames. If you want your windows to last, think about selecting a reputable company with a wide selection of frames, and offers customized options.

Although the cost of replacing windows can vary according to the size and design of your home, it is possible to get an estimate by looking at quotes. Get at least three estimates for free to gain a better understanding of what you can expect to pay.

Professional installation can help you save money if you're interested in having windows installed. Many window companies provide trade-only pricing which means that if you're willing to negotiate with your local window company it could be possible to get a better price.

While you can find an estimate on the internet, it's not a reliable source. Prices will vary based on where you reside and the size of your windows and the material you choose.

The amount of units you replace also influences the cost of replacing. Certain homes could have up to 30 windows. The choice of a window design that is able to accommodate a large amount of glass may be costly. It is also possible to modify your frame or siding to accommodate the new window.

Selecting the right type window

Choosing the right type of replacement double glazed windows is an important choice. It could affect the efficiency of your energy, comfort, and even your home's appearance. There are different styles and features that can help you choose the right window for you.

For example there are special glasses that are designed to keep heat in and cold out. Glass coatings can also be used to boost efficiency in energy use. It is possible to have artwork printed on your glass. However, choosing the right windows is a complex process. There are experts in the field who can help you.

First, you must take into consideration the size of your window. The windows with the largest size tend to cost more. However, the smaller ones are more affordable. Also, the kind of material used for frames is an additional element. Vinyl, wood, fiberglass and some composite frames have greater thermal resistance than metal.

Then, you'll have to think about what spacers you'll choose to use. These are designed to decrease the frame's size. In general the insulation plastics should be placed between the frame and the sash. A thermal break should be installed if your window is made from metal. Metal is a great conductor of heat and an insulating gap between the sash and frame can help to reduce that.

You must also take into consideration the material's quality. Window manufacturers have made significant strides in recreating the look and feel from aluminium or wooden frames. This includes the use UPVC that is pre-colored and moldable. In addition, the cost of installing UPVC is less than many other materials.

The signs that a new window is required

It is recommended to replace windows that are in poor condition or old. This will not only enhance the appearance of your home, but also your comfort. Old windows can cause high energy costs. Replacement of windows can also boost the value of your home.

Windows are vital for letting sunlight into a home. Windows can increase curb appeal and lower energy bills. They can also assist with sound abatement. The more robust and well-designed and durable your windows are, the more natural light you'll receive, and the greater the efficiency of your home.

Window technology has advanced considerably in the last decade, and windows of the present are more durable. But, despite all these improvements, even the best windows won't last forever. You should be looking out for signs that a window could need to be replaced by a double-glazed model.

Leakage along with condensation, rotting and warping are just a few of the most obvious signs that a window needs to be replaced. Leaks in windows can cause lot of water to accumulate on the inside of the home. Condensation can also lead to mold growth on the frame. Although it can be difficult to eliminate this buildup, it is crucial to take care to do so.

The broken seals are another indication that your windows should be replaced. Cracks or tears in the seal can lead to moisture accumulation between the panes. This can result in increased electric bills as well as windows that appear cloudy.

Another sign of a need for a new double-glazed window is a sagging frame. Your windows may not open and close properly if they are damaged. Also, warped frames are an indication that the size of the aperture in the window isn't suitable for the window.
